この記事の由来は Cointelegraphこの記事の由来は

、原著者:アンドリュー・フェントン、Odailyの翻訳者ケイティ・クーによって編集されました。
ビットコインの支持者たちは、「自分自身の銀行になれ」というフレーズを何年も繰り返してきました。しかし実際のところ、どのような仮想通貨であっても財布に保管することは現金をマットレスの下に隠すのと何ら変わりなく、この「価値が上がらないシンプルさ」は銀行などの複雑な金融機関とは程遠いものです。
DeFiは改善です。暗号通貨は数分で世界中に転送でき、ブロックチェーン技術によって安全に保護されています。しかし、銀行に比べて「使いやすさ」が著しく劣り、提供される機能も充実していません。ウォレットを設定する複雑なプロセスを理解していても、パスワードが盗まれる可能性があり、ウォレット内のシードフレーズと「家族の財産」が永久に失われる可能性があります。
この状況は、最近の ETHDenver でのイーサリアム上の「スマート アカウント」(「アカウント抽象化」とも呼ばれます)と、イーサリアム仮想マシン(EVM)と互換性のある他のすべてのチェーンに関する驚くべき発表によってすべて変わります(EVM はイーサリアムベースのスマートコントラクトの実行を担当するソフトウェア)。現在スマート アカウントを利用できるチェーンには、Polygon、Optimism、Arbitrum、BNB Smart Chain、Avalanche、Gnosis Chain などがあります。
長年の「構想」を経て、新しい ERC-4337 標準は暗号通貨ウォレットを銀行のすべての機能を備えた製品に変えます。 「仮想通貨ウォレットは、銀行を信頼する必要がなく、銀行と同じ機能を提供します」と、イーサリアム財団のセキュリティ研究者で、ヴィタリック氏とイーサリアム改善提案書(EIP)を共同執筆したヨアヴ・ワイス氏は述べた。
「アカウントの抽象化は、次の 10 億人のユーザーを引き付ける方法になるでしょう。」
アカウント抽象化の利点には、2 要素認証、携帯電話でのトランザクションへの署名、アカウントの毎月の支出制限の設定、トランザクションを常に承認することなくセッション キーを使用してブロックチェーン ゲームをプレイすること、ウォレットの分散リカバリ、スマート アカウントは請求書とサブスクリプションを自動的に支払うように設定できることなどが含まれます。等アカウントの抽象化は、暗号通貨のユーザー エクスペリエンスに革命をもたらします。

アカウント抽象化タイムライン (Yoav Weiss)
副題
アカウントの抽象化とはどういう意味ですか?
アカウントの抽象化は、実際には非常に親しみやすいものを説明するために使用される複雑な専門用語です。 Weiss と zkSync は、これをよりわかりやすい用語「スマート アカウント」に置き換えたいと考えています。
「アカウントの抽象化は紛らわしい用語です。これらのアカウントはネットワークから抽象化されていますが、ユーザーから抽象化されていません。ユーザーは、非常に特殊なことを行う非常に特殊なウォレットを使用しています。...ユーザーの観点から見ると、ユーザーは非常に特殊なウォレットを使用しています。これはスマート アカウントを使用することに似ています。」
MetaMaskのシニアプロダクトマネージャーであるAlex Jupiter氏は、「アカウントの抽象化」は開発者によって意味が異なると述べた。 StarkWare や zkSync などの非 EVM スケーリング ソリューションがプロトコル自体に ERC-4337 の修正バージョンを実装する限り、イーサリアムは標準化を達成しました。
Weiss 氏は次のように説明しました。「相互運用性と最適化に重点を置き、どこでも機能する標準を考え出しました。これは、ロールアップなどのプロトコル レベルでより効率的に実行できます。」
ネイティブ実装を通じてすべてのユーザー アカウントをスマート アカウントにアップグレードしますが、イーサリアムの新しい標準ではユーザーが新しいアカウントをセットアップする必要があります。 Weiss 氏は、「将来的にすべてのアカウントのアップグレードを実現するにはハードフォークが発生することは避けられませんが、これが起こるまでには長い時間がかかるでしょう。」と説明しました。
副題
スマートアカウントの利点は何ですか?
スマート アカウントを採用する最大のメリットの 1 つは、新規ユーザーが複雑なシード フレーズを心配したり、ウォレットを設定する技術的なプロセスを理解したりすることなく、分散型暗号の世界に「スムーズに」参加できることです。必要なのは、指紋または顔スキャナーを使用してスマートフォン アプリを通じてスマート アカウントを開くことだけです。
現在、スマホアプリとして利用できる仮想通貨ウォレットは数多くありますが、セキュリティ上のリスクが多く、ハッキングの危険性があるため、大量の仮想通貨を保有するのには適していません。しかし、スマート アカウントが携帯電話のハードウェア セキュリティ モジュールに暗号化された秘密キーを保存できる機能のおかげで、モバイル ウォレットはハードウェア ウォレットとほぼ同じくらい安全になるようになりました。
既存の仮想通貨ユーザーは、真の仮想通貨ウォレットとは何か、またそれにアクセスする方法を再検討する必要があります。非保管カートリッジ コントローラーは、実際には StarkNet と対話する Web ベースのウォレットです。通常の秘密キーの代わりに、Android または Apple の「秘密キー」を使用します。どちらの「秘密キー」も、公開キー暗号化を使用して Web アプリケーションのユーザー認証を標準化する試みである Web Authentication Standard (WebAuthn) に基づいています。

画像の説明
長年の仮想通貨ユーザーにとってウェブウォレットは恐ろしい提案のように聞こえるが、レジャーの共同創設者ニコラス・バッカ氏はカートリッジウェブウォレットに感銘を受け、レジャーは同様のウェブベースのウォレットを開発中で、ウェブ認証が備わっていると述べた。 」、財布は安全です。
副題
スマートフォンをハードウェアウォレットとして使用するスマートフォンをハードウェアウォレットとして使用するには、いくつかの問題があります。スマートフォンの画面は、ユーザーを騙して取引を承認させるためにハッキングされる可能性があるため、セキュリティ上のリスクがあります。
ただし、スマート アカウントを使用すると、ユーザーが高額のトランザクション (ハードウェア ウォレットの使用など) に 2 要素認証を必要とする権限を設定したり、アカウント内から毎日、毎月、または年間の支出制限を設定したりできるため、このリスクは軽減できます。
Ledgerの共同創設者Nicolas Bacca氏は、Ledgerは現在この機能を実験中であると述べた。同氏は、「たとえば、少額だけを購入したい場合は携帯電話を使用できます。大量の商品を購入したい場合は、アカウント内でスクリプトを作成できるハードウェアウォレットを使用できます。 Web アプリケーションのプロトタイプです。」
イーサリアムでスマホウォレットを利用する場合の大きな問題は、セキュリティモジュールが暗号化とは異なる暗号署名方式(楕円曲線)を利用していることです。スマート アカウントを使用すると、最終的に 2 つのシステムが相互に通信できるようになりますが、これには多くの操作と高額なガス料金が必要になります。StarkNet のスマートフォンベースの Braavos ウォレットの創設者である Motty Lavie 氏は、スマートフォンのセキュリティ モジュールを悪用するには 240,000 の計算ステップが必要だと述べました。
「イーサリアムでこれを実現するには、トランザクションあたりのコストが非常に高くなります。StarkNet では限界コストであり、トランザクション手数料は数セントしか増加しないため、実現可能です。」
イーサリアム財団のセキュリティ研究者であるヨアヴ・ワイス氏は、「これらのウォレットが注目を集め、ユーザーの粘着性が強化され、ユーザーがこの強力な使いやすさに慣れれば、イーサリアム自体でこの変更を促進することが容易になるでしょう。これを追加できれば」と述べた。プリコンパイルすれば、エコシステムにとって大きな変革となります。」

アカウント抽象化タイムライン (Yoav Weiss)
副題
アカウントを回復するにはどうすればよいですか?
ワイス氏は次のように説明しました。「銀行口座にアクセスできなくなることを心配する必要はありません。PIN を紛失した場合は、いつでも銀行に電話すれば、本人確認を行って PIN をリセットしてくれます。回復サービスを利用したり、電話をリセットしたりすることができます」ウォレットのパスワードもありますが、ウォレットを盗むことはできず、取り戻すのに役立つだけです。」

画像の説明
Motty Lavie、StarkWare Sessions Braavos Wallet 共同創設者 (Twitter)
Braavos は、シード フレーズの作成を含む、時間ロックされた回復プロセスを採用しています。通常のシード フレーズとは異なり、このフレーズは 4 日後にのみアカウントへのアクセスを回復するリクエストを送信できます。彼が追加した:"知恵
Braavos 氏は、ゼロ知識証明を使用してニーモニックを「隠す」ことにも取り組んでおり、これが UX (ユーザー エクスペリエンス) の大きな動きになると考えています。
副題
チェーンゲームスマートウォレット
Bacca 氏は、Ledger がすでに Argent および Cartridge と協力して、StarkWare のプレイヤーがセッション秘密鍵を設定できるようにする「プラグイン」の開発に取り組んでおり、多数の低コストのトランザクションが自動的に完了するため、ユーザーが煩雑にならないようにしていると説明しました。それぞれを承認するのに苦労しなければなりません。
「アカウントに小さなコードをロードして、特定のゲームでの動作を変更することができます。たとえば、『特定のゲームをプレイしたい場合』のコードを入力すると、次のようになります」と彼は言います。トランザクションは自動的に署名されます。「1 時間です。それが、アカウントの抽象化が暗号通貨のユーザー エクスペリエンスに革命をもたらすと思う理由です。」 スマート アカウントとは、ゲーム開発者が「ペイマスター」になることを決定し、使用を奨励するために取引手数料を支払うことを決定できることを意味します。
MetaMask は、新しいウォレット機能の開発を外部委託 (クラウドソーシング) する Snaps と呼ばれる新機能を開発しています。これにより、スマート アカウントの革新的な使用が可能になる可能性があります。 Snap for Smart Accounts は ETH India で開発され、「ベスト ERC-4337 ツール」の称号を獲得しました。
副題
スマートアカウントで「仮想通貨で商品の購読」が可能に
12月に戻って、Visaの暗号研究チームは、StarkWareのスマートアカウントを使用して、住宅ローン、テレビの購読、セルフカストディアル暗号ウォレットからの公共料金の支払いを自動化する方法を示す論文を発表しました。
Visa Cryptoは次のように説明しました:「秘密鍵によって制御されるユーザーアカウントはトランザクションを送信でき、スマートコントラクトには実行可能なコードが関連付けられていますが、スマートコントラクト自体がトランザクションを開始することはできません。トランザクションは常にユーザーアカウントから送信され、ユーザーアカウントによって署名される必要があります。」ユーザー。"

画像の説明
Visa Cryptoは、仮想通貨口座から請求書を自動的に送金する方法を考案しました。出典:ビザ公式サイトしたがって、2 週間ごとに暗号通貨で支払う場合は、資金がウォレットに入金された後、各請求書を支払うために「プッシュ」トランザクションを手動で開始する必要があります。スマート アカウントを使用すると、簿記担当者が開始する「固定自動」支払いが可能になります。
たとえば、電力会社は、Web サイト上に自動支払いのためのスマート コントラクトを設定し、その機能をリストすることができます。たとえば、月に 1 つのトランザクションのみを開始でき、請求される最大金額を設定します。ユーザーは、スマート アカウントを通じてこれらの条件付きの「固定自動」支払いを承認できるため、隔週の給与が到着したときに自動請求書支払いが可能になります。突然、
暗号化テクノロジーは、一連の新しい支払いアプリケーションに搭載されています。
「アカウントのスクリプトを作成できれば、Web2 で行ったことと同様の使用例をさらに多く考えることができます。」

アカウント抽象化のタイムライン。ヨアヴ・ワイスより。
副題
ERC-4337はどのように機能しますか?
スマート アカウントでサポートされている機能の一部は、Gnosis と Argent のスマート コントラクト ウォレットを通じてすでに実装されています。ただし、これらのソリューションでは、操作のトランザクション手数料を支払うために集中コンポーネントであるリレーが必要です。イーサリアムの新しい ERC-4337 標準は、「バンドラー」と呼ばれる新しい分散インフラストラクチャとともに、この部分を「分散」します。
プロセス: スマートウォレットは、特別なメモリプールに対してトリガーされる「ユーザーアクション」に署名します。このメモリプールは、基本的に単なるトランザクションの組織化されたキューです(ただし、イーサリアムの通常のメモリプールとは異なります)。 「バンドラー」はマイナーやバリデータのようなもので、メモリプールからユーザーのアクションを取得し、必要な結果をウォレットに送り返します。バンドラーは必要なガス取引手数料も支払います。この手数料は、ユーザーの契約アカウントまたは「ペイマスター」と呼ばれる第三者によって支払われます。これは分散アプリケーションである可能性もあれば、ウォレット プロバイダーである可能性もあります。


